>>> Jamal Mazrui collected some documentation together for PowerShell, and did a bit of scripting with it at one time (it's been out for at least 3 years). It can
> be installed in Windows XP, and comes standard with Vista and 7. As far as I can tell, it's an expanded version of the Windows command-line processor,
> and you use it in console mode. So if you can get JAWS to read the console satisfactorily, you should be able to do a lot.
